Answer:

F. y = .25x + 3

Step-by-step explanation:

use the slope equation m = y2-y1/x2-x1 with the points. so for this problem it would look like: m = 6-2/12-(-4) which is 1/4 (.25).

For the y-intercept plug what you already know (slope and a set of points) into the slope-intercept formula: 2 = .25(-4) + b and solve.

2 = -1 +b

+1 ( add the one)

b = 3 and that's the y-intercept
